Federal property tax applies to giant estates.

Whereas Florida doesn’t impose a state-level inheritance tax, the federal authorities does impose an property tax on estates valued over a sure threshold. This threshold is called the federal property tax exemption. For people, the exemption quantity in 2023 is $12.92 million. For married {couples}, the mixed exemption quantity is $25.84 million. Which means that if the full worth of a person’s or couple’s property exceeds these quantities, federal property tax could also be due upon their dying.

The federal property tax fee is progressive, starting from 18% to 40%. The upper the worth of the property, the upper the relevant tax fee. It is essential to notice that the property tax is a tax on the switch of wealth at dying, not on the belongings themselves. Due to this fact, the tax is barely paid as soon as, when the property is transferred to the beneficiaries.

Exemption threshold varies for people and {couples}.

The federal property tax exemption threshold varies relying on whether or not the person is single or married. The exemption quantity can be adjusted periodically for inflation.

  • People:

    For people, the federal property tax exemption for 2023 is $12.92 million. Which means that if the full worth of a person’s property is lower than $12.92 million, no federal property tax will likely be due. Nonetheless, if the worth of the property exceeds this quantity, the property will likely be topic to federal property tax on the quantity over the exemption.

  • Married {couples}:

    Married {couples} have a mixed federal property tax exemption of $25.84 million for 2023. Which means that a married couple can switch as much as $25.84 million to their beneficiaries with out incurring federal property tax. The mixed exemption quantity is transportable between spouses, that means that if one partner passes away, the surviving partner can use any unused portion of the deceased partner’s exemption.

  • Annual exclusion:

    Along with the property tax exemption, people may also make items of as much as $17,000 per recipient every year with out incurring reward tax. Married {couples} can reward as much as $34,000 per recipient every year. This annual exclusion can be utilized to steadily switch wealth to family members and scale back the worth of the property for property tax functions.

  • Indexing for inflation:

    The federal property tax exemption quantity is listed for inflation every year. Which means that the exemption quantity will increase over time to maintain tempo with the rising value of residing. The aim of indexing is to make sure that the property tax doesn’t develop into a burden for increasingly more households as inflation erodes the worth of the exemption.

It is essential to notice that the property tax exemption is a unified credit score, that means that it applies to each lifetime items and transfers at dying. Which means that if a person makes taxable items throughout their lifetime, the worth of these items will scale back the quantity of the property tax exemption out there at dying.

Gifting methods can scale back taxable property worth.

One of the crucial efficient methods to scale back the taxable worth of an property is to make items to family members throughout your lifetime. It’s because items will not be topic to property tax, so long as they’re made inside sure limits.

  • Annual exclusion items:

    Every year, people can provide as much as $17,000 to any variety of recipients with out incurring reward tax. Married {couples} can provide as much as $34,000 per recipient. This is called the annual exclusion. By making annual exclusion items, people can steadily switch wealth to their family members whereas decreasing the worth of their taxable property.

  • Direct fee of medical and academic bills:

    People may also make limitless items to cowl the direct fee of medical and academic bills for his or her family members. This implies that you would be able to pay for your beloved’s medical payments or tuition on to the supplier with out it being thought of a taxable reward.

  • Items to charity:

    Items to certified charitable organizations will not be topic to reward tax, whatever the quantity. This could be a beneficial property planning instrument for people with giant estates, because it permits them to scale back the worth of their taxable property whereas additionally supporting causes they care about.

  • Items to a partner:

    Items between spouses will not be topic to reward tax, whatever the quantity. Which means that married {couples} can switch limitless quantities of wealth between themselves with none tax penalties. Nonetheless, it is essential to notice that these items should be made outright, that means that the partner will need to have full possession and management of the gifted property.

Property planning minimizes tax affect.

Property planning is the method of arranging your affairs upfront to make sure that your belongings are distributed in line with your needs after your dying. Property planning may also assist to reduce the affect of property taxes in your heirs. By implementing efficient property planning methods, you’ll be able to scale back the quantity of taxes that your property will owe, permitting extra of your wealth to go to your family members.

There are a variety of property planning instruments that can be utilized to reduce taxes, together with:

  • Revocable residing trusts:

    A revocable residing belief is a authorized entity that holds belongings throughout your lifetime. Upon your dying, the belongings within the belief are distributed to your beneficiaries. Revocable residing trusts may also help to keep away from probate, which is the authorized technique of distributing a deceased particular person’s belongings. They’ll additionally assist to scale back property taxes by permitting you to switch belongings to your beneficiaries outdoors of your property.

  • Irrevocable life insurance coverage trusts:

    An irrevocable life insurance coverage belief is a kind of belief that’s used to personal and handle a life insurance coverage coverage. The dying profit from the life insurance coverage coverage is paid to the belief, which then distributes the proceeds to the beneficiaries. Irrevocable life insurance coverage trusts can be utilized to take away the proceeds of the life insurance coverage coverage out of your property, thereby decreasing the worth of your taxable property.

  • Charitable giving:

    Items to certified charitable organizations will not be topic to property tax. This implies that you would be able to scale back the worth of your taxable property by making charitable items throughout your lifetime or via your will. Charitable giving may also offer you earnings tax deductions throughout your lifetime.

  • Era-skipping trusts:

    Era-skipping trusts are trusts which might be designed to go wealth on to grandchildren or later generations, skipping over the youngsters’s era. This may also help to scale back property taxes by preserving the belongings within the belief out of the taxable estates of a number of generations.

Charitable giving can scale back tax legal responsibility.

Making charitable items throughout your lifetime or via your will can present important tax advantages. Listed here are a couple of ways in which charitable giving can scale back your tax legal responsibility:

  • Earnings tax deduction:

    Whenever you make a charitable reward throughout your lifetime, you’ll be able to declare an earnings tax deduction for the quantity of the reward. This will scale back your taxable earnings and prevent cash in your taxes.

  • Property tax deduction:

    Items to certified charitable organizations will not be topic to property tax. This implies that you would be able to scale back the worth of your taxable property by making charitable items throughout your lifetime or via your will. This will save your heirs a big amount of cash in property taxes.

  • Certified charitable distributions (QCDs):

    People who’re age 70½ or older could make certified charitable distributions (QCDs) from their IRAs. QCDs are tax-free withdrawals that can be utilized to make charitable items. QCDs could be a good method to scale back your taxable earnings and fulfill your required minimal distributions (RMDs).

  • Charitable reward annuities:

    A charitable reward annuity is a contract between you and a certified charity. You switch money or different belongings to the charity, and the charity agrees to pay you a set amount of cash every year for the remainder of your life. Charitable reward annuities can offer you a gentle stream of earnings whereas additionally decreasing your taxable earnings and property tax legal responsibility.
